Transaction 586457703d829dfdf3faa570c05012c0c1546ef391810149563bdaa307fe8bf6

1 Input
2 Outputs
  • 586457703d829dfdf3faa570c05012c0c1546ef391810149563bdaa307fe8bf6:0
  • value  400000
    address  19ur3yah1eu4kfssVnqrymyNQ3cizU3Zb9
  • 586457703d829dfdf3faa570c05012c0c1546ef391810149563bdaa307fe8bf6:1
  • value  4858976
    address  3LceCjhHgzYAtUWHqbGPEBRw19nieKZvBV